CAGS Bypass Harness Installation
The
C4 and C5 six speed manual transmissions will force you to shift from 1st
to 4th if you accelerate slowly and shift at a set speed range. This
is done to improve corporate fuel average, but can be very annoying. A CAGS
bypass harness is available from suppliers such as Eckler’s and Mid America.
Installation
is very easy and takes only 15 minutes or so. These photos are from our ’96.
The C5 installation was similar.
1. As always, when working under you car,
support it securely on jack stands.
2. The CAGS connection is gray colored and
located on the left side of the transmission. Gently lift the locking clip and
separate the connection. (Photo 1)
3. There are two connection pieces in the
kit. One part plugs into the forward harness connector, and the other into the
aft connector.
4. The kit also includes several wire zip
ties. Use them to secure the plugs to the existing wire harness. (Photo 2)
That’s all there is to it. Now, when you’re stuck in traffic and moving slowly, you can shift from 1st to 2nd at any speed or acceleration rate.
